General Summary:
The Nursing Professional Development (NPD) Practitioner is a Registered Nurse (RN) who influences professional role competence and professional growth in an interprofessional environment that facilitates continuous development and learning for the healthcare professionals. The NPD Practitioner implements the tools, skills, and knowledge of the specialty to improve healthcare practice of learners through seven distinct roles: learning facilitator, change agent, mentor, leader, champion for scientific-inquiry, advocate for role development, and partner for collaboration and practice transitions.
Responsibilities:
1. Facilitator of Learninga. Develop and evaluate core curriculab. Assess learning needs through assessment and analysis of feedback outcomesc. Lead experiential learning activities through innovative teaching and learning methods.
2. Change Agent - Foster acceptance, adoption, and action toward change.
3. Mentor and Leadera. Validates clinical performanceb. Establish effective communication networks with unit and organizational leadership.
4. Champion Scientific Inquiry - Create a supportive environment for nursing research, evidence-based practice, quality improvement and integrating into clinical practice.
5. Advocate for role development a. Facilitate orientation processes, nurse residency program, and role transitions with a focus on retention and growth.'Develops, coordinates, and evaluates competency programs and identifies deficiencies in staff competency.
6. Partner for Collaboration and Practice Transitions a. Collaborates with interprofessional teams, leaders, stakeholders and others to facilitate nursing practice and positive outcomes both internally and within the community.b. Partners with shared governance councils at the unit and system level to effect nursing practice and generate positive outcomes.
7. All other duties as assigned within the scope and range of job responsibilities
